皮肤晚期糖基化终末产物与2型糖尿病合并下肢动脉病变的相关性

摘    要:目的 分析2型糖尿病伴下肢动脉病变患者皮肤晚期糖基化终末产物(AGEs)水平变化及其临床意义.方法 111 例2 型糖尿病患者,依据 ABI(ankle-brachial index,踝肱指数)不同将其分为DM1组(0.9≤ABI≤1.3,n=46)、PAD1组(0.5≤ABI〈0.9,n=51)、PAD2组(ABI〈0.5,n=14),正常对照组35例,为同期体检健康人群.分别测定皮肤AGEs、糖化血红蛋白、ABI等指标.结果 与正常对照组相比,糖尿病患者皮肤AGEs水平明显升高(P〈0.05);与DM1组相比,PAD组皮肤AGEs水平明显增高(P〈0.05),且PAD2组皮肤AGEs水平明显高于PAD1组.结论 2 型糖尿病患者皮肤AGEs水平升高并可能参与了糖尿病下肢血管病变的发生,可以作为反映糖尿病下肢血管病变程度的指标之一.

Correlation research between skin advanced glycation end products and peripheral artery disease in type 2 diabetes mellitus

Abstract:Objective To analyze the level changes and clinical significance of skin advanced glycation end products (SAGEs) in type 2 diabetes with peripheral artery diseases. Methods According to the ankle - brachial index, 111 patients with type 2 diabetes were di- vided into three groups:DM1 group (0.9≤ABI≤1. 3 ,n =46) ,PAD1 group (0.5 ≤ABI 〈0.9,n =51 ) ,and PAD2 group ( ABI 〈0.5 ,n = 14) ;35 cases of normal control group were selected from the medical center for healthy people. SAGEs, glycated hemoglobin (HbA1 c), ABI and other index were detected. Results Compared with normal control group, SAGEs level was obviously increased in patients with diabetes (P 〈 0.05 ) , compared with DM1 group, the level of SAGEs also increased in PAD group, and the level of SAGEs in PAD2 group was higher than that in PAD1 group. Conclusion The SAGEs level was obviously increased in patients with type 2 diabetes ,which may be involved in the pathogenesis of PAD, and could be used as an index for evaluating the severity of PAD.
